The available plans and programs include: Comprehensive benefits for medical, prescription drug, dental, vision, behavioral health and telemedicine services Wellbeing support, including free counseling and referral services Time away from work programs for paid time off, paid family leave, long- and short-term disability coverage and leaves of absence Savings and retirement resources, including a 401(k) Plan with a 100% match on 3% to 9% of pay (based on years of service), Employee Stock Purchase Plan, flexible spending accounts, preferred banking partnerships, retirement readiness tools, rollover support and financial wellbeing counseling Education support through tuition assistance, student loan assistance, certification support, dependent scholarships and a partnership with Galen College of Nursing Additional benefits for fertility and family building, adoption assistance, life insurance, supplemental health protection plans, auto and home insurance, legal counseling, identity theft protection and consumer discounts Learn more about Employee Benefits Note: Eligibility for benefits may vary by location Medical City Fort Worth is a 350+ bed full-service Magnet Designated hospital. It is located in the heart of the medical district. Medical City Fort Worth serves as a tertiary referral center for Tarrant County and many counties within a 90 mile radius. We offer comprehensive diagnostic and treatment services. Our specialties include cardiac care, neurosciences and oncology. We have surgical services, orthopedics, kidney transplants and emergency care. We offer three ER locations, including two off campus ER located in Burleson and White Settlement. Medical City Fort Worth is a designated comprehensive stroke center. We are a Joint Commission chest pain center. We are a part of the Medical City network of hospitals. Job Description The LVN, with a focus on patient safety, is required to function within the parameters of the legal scope of practice and in accordance with the federal, state, and local laws; rules and regulations; and policies, procedures and guidelines of the employing health care institution or practice setting. The LVN functions under his or her own license and assumes accountability and responsibility for quality of care provided to patients and their families according to the standards of nursing practice.7 The LVN demonstrates responsibility forcontinued competence in nursing practice, and develops insight through reflection, self-analysis, self-care, and lifelong learning. This LVN, in a non-primary care nurse role, will meet the needs of patients (inpatient or outpatient) requiring education, assistance, and/or guidance related to lactation. The LVN will act as a surgical technologist to serve as an integral part of the team of medical practitioners providing surgical care to patients. The LVN will work under the supervision of a circulating RN and/or physician to facilitate the safe and effective conduct of invasive surgical procedures, ensuring that the operating room environment is safe, that equipment functions properly, and that the operative procedure is conducted under conditions that maximize patient safety. SHIFT AND SCHEDULE 7:00 AM - 7:00 PM 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S/PERFORMANCE EXPECTATIONS · Complete a comprehensive assessment. This includes the ongoing, extensive collection, analysis and interpretation of data. · Synthesize the data collected during the comprehensive assessment to identify problems, and to formulate goals, teaching plans and outcomes in collaboration with primary RN. · The LVN may begin and deliver interventions within the plan of care for patients within legal, ethical, and regulatory parameters and in consideration of health restoration, disease prevention, wellness, and promotion of healthy lifestyles. · Evaluate and report patient outcomes and responses to therapeutic interventions in comparison to benchmarks from evidence-based practice and research findings, and plans any follow-up care and referrals to appropriate resources that may be needed.· Makes appropriate decisions in collaboration with the primary care RN· Ability to assess, project and plan for procedural needs· Possess expertise in the theory and application of sterile and aseptic technique.· Combine the knowledge of human anatomy, surgical procedures, and implementation tools and technologies to facilitate a physician's performance of safe patient outcomes. E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E · Current Texas Licensed Vocational Nursing license required.· NRP and ACLS required within 6 months of hire.· Ability to assess, project and plan for procedural needs· Possess expertise in the theory and application of sterile and aseptic technique.· Combine the knowledge of human anatomy, surgical procedures, and implementationtools and technologies to facilitate a physician's performance of invasive therapeutic anddiagnostic procedures.· Required to completed (3) hours of hospital provided continuing education upon hire andannually for Advanced Sterile Processing Certification. Education will focus on thehandling of soiled instrumentation at the point of use and storage of instrumentation forsterile processing department pick-up.
